Output f5c68e534fae5ae61a370e3709fbe8b538e90b6fcdba2d555dcaeb720297a5d4:1

value
24049814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21ed119637b8406c8784b0885a93aa60a92a947 OP_EQUAL
address
3Hvq7ssc71dG2PC1BTmCu9sW2Q8Tf81Qe7
transaction
f5c68e534fae5ae61a370e3709fbe8b538e90b6fcdba2d555dcaeb720297a5d4
confirmations
475542
spent
true